- ➤ Local food banks face added stress as SNAP cuts reduce benefits for low-income families, making it harder for them to purchase healthy food. The program helps families buy nutritious food with an electronic benefits card (Oklahoma Department of Human Services). Stillwater News Press
- ➤ The Billups family received a two-bedroom, one-bath home from Habitat for Humanity in Stillwater on Wednesday. They celebrated with friends and family with a ribbon cutting — housewarming gifts, prayer, and refreshments marked the event. Stillwater News Press

- ➤ On Tuesday, four of the 100 new state laws in Oklahoma changed rules for higher education by expanding Oklahoma’s Promise eligibility, revising National Guard tuition fee coverage, ending state funding for DEI initiatives, and limiting student advisory roles — these changes will impact financial aid programs and student participation in colleges.
